Senate vote: Cloture motion // October 4, 2017

Motion to Invoke Cloture Re: Eric D. Hargan to be Deputy Secretary of Health and Human Services

Who won, and how much of the country was behind them

Won the vote · Yea

57 votes, representing 118,475,204 people47.1%of U.S. adults

Lost the vote · Nay

38 votes, representing 123,371,867 people49.1%of U.S. adults

The dotted gap is 3.8% of U.S. adults whose member did not vote, voted “present,” or whose seat was vacant.

Share of U.S. adults represented, the Senate. The winning side fell 2.9 points short of a majority of the country.
